mbed_official 610:813dcc80987e 87 /** @defgroup PWR_PVD_detection_level Programmable Voltage Detection levels
mbed_official 610:813dcc80987e 88 * @{
mbed_official 610:813dcc80987e 89 */
mbed_official 610:813dcc80987e 90 #define PWR_PVDLEVEL_0 PWR_CR2_PLS_LEV0 /*!< PVD threshold around 2.0 V */
mbed_official 610:813dcc80987e 91 #define PWR_PVDLEVEL_1 PWR_CR2_PLS_LEV1 /*!< PVD threshold around 2.2 V */
mbed_official 610:813dcc80987e 92 #define PWR_PVDLEVEL_2 PWR_CR2_PLS_LEV2 /*!< PVD threshold around 2.4 V */
mbed_official 610:813dcc80987e 93 #define PWR_PVDLEVEL_3 PWR_CR2_PLS_LEV3 /*!< PVD threshold around 2.5 V */
mbed_official 610:813dcc80987e 94 #define PWR_PVDLEVEL_4 PWR_CR2_PLS_LEV4 /*!< PVD threshold around 2.6 V */
mbed_official 610:813dcc80987e 95 #define PWR_PVDLEVEL_5 PWR_CR2_PLS_LEV5 /*!< PVD threshold around 2.8 V */
mbed_official 610:813dcc80987e 96 #define PWR_PVDLEVEL_6 PWR_CR2_PLS_LEV6 /*!< PVD threshold around 2.9 V */
mbed_official 610:813dcc80987e 97 #define PWR_PVDLEVEL_7 PWR_CR2_PLS_LEV7 /*!< External input analog voltage (compared internally to VREFINT) */
mbed_official 610:813dcc80987e 98 /**
mbed_official 610:813dcc80987e 99 * @}
mbed_official 610:813dcc80987e 100 */
mbed_official 610:813dcc80987e 101
mbed_official 610:813dcc80987e 102 /** @defgroup PWR_PVD_Mode PWR PVD interrupt and event mode
mbed_official 610:813dcc80987e 103 * @{
mbed_official 610:813dcc80987e 104 */
mbed_official 610:813dcc80987e 105 #define PWR_PVD_MODE_NORMAL ((uint32_t)0x00000000) /*!< basic mode is used */
mbed_official 610:813dcc80987e 106 #define PWR_PVD_MODE_IT_RISING ((uint32_t)0x00010001) /*!< External Interrupt Mode with Rising edge trigger detection */
mbed_official 610:813dcc80987e 107 #define PWR_PVD_MODE_IT_FALLING ((uint32_t)0x00010002) /*!< External Interrupt Mode with Falling edge trigger detection */
mbed_official 610:813dcc80987e 108 #define PWR_PVD_MODE_IT_RISING_FALLING ((uint32_t)0x00010003) /*!< External Interrupt Mode with Rising/Falling edge trigger detection */
mbed_official 610:813dcc80987e 109 #define PWR_PVD_MODE_EVENT_RISING ((uint32_t)0x00020001) /*!< Event Mode with Rising edge trigger detection */
mbed_official 610:813dcc80987e 110 #define PWR_PVD_MODE_EVENT_FALLING ((uint32_t)0x00020002) /*!< Event Mode with Falling edge trigger detection */
mbed_official 610:813dcc80987e 111 #define PWR_PVD_MODE_EVENT_RISING_FALLING ((uint32_t)0x00020003) /*!< Event Mode with Rising/Falling edge trigger detection */

mbed_official 610:813dcc80987e 172 /** @brief Check whether or not a specific PWR flag is set.
mbed_official 610:813dcc80987e 173 * @param __FLAG__: specifies the flag to check.
mbed_official 610:813dcc80987e 174 * This parameter can be one of the following values:
mbed_official 610:813dcc80987e 175 * @arg PWR_FLAG_WUF1: Wake Up Flag 1. Indicates that a wakeup event
mbed_official 610:813dcc80987e 176 * was received from the WKUP pin 1.
mbed_official 610:813dcc80987e 177 * @arg PWR_FLAG_WUF2: Wake Up Flag 2. Indicates that a wakeup event
mbed_official 610:813dcc80987e 178 * was received from the WKUP pin 2.
mbed_official 610:813dcc80987e 179 * @arg PWR_FLAG_WUF3: Wake Up Flag 3. Indicates that a wakeup event
mbed_official 610:813dcc80987e 180 * was received from the WKUP pin 3.
mbed_official 610:813dcc80987e 181 * @arg PWR_FLAG_WUF4: Wake Up Flag 4. Indicates that a wakeup event
mbed_official 610:813dcc80987e 182 * was received from the WKUP pin 4.
mbed_official 610:813dcc80987e 183 * @arg PWR_FLAG_WUF5: Wake Up Flag 5. Indicates that a wakeup event
mbed_official 610:813dcc80987e 184 * was received from the WKUP pin 5.
mbed_official 610:813dcc80987e 185 * @arg PWR_FLAG_SB: StandBy Flag. Indicates that the system
mbed_official 610:813dcc80987e 186 * entered StandBy mode.
mbed_official 610:813dcc80987e 187 * @arg PWR_FLAG_WUFI: Wake-Up Flag Internal. Set when a wakeup is detected on
mbed_official 610:813dcc80987e 188 * the internal wakeup line.
mbed_official 610:813dcc80987e 189 * @arg PWR_FLAG_REGLPS: Low Power Regulator Started. Indicates whether or not the
mbed_official 610:813dcc80987e 190 * low-power regulator is ready.
mbed_official 610:813dcc80987e 191 * @arg PWR_FLAG_REGLPF: Low Power Regulator Flag. Indicates whether the
mbed_official 610:813dcc80987e 192 * regulator is ready in main mode or is in low-power mode.
mbed_official 610:813dcc80987e 193 * @arg PWR_FLAG_VOSF: Voltage Scaling Flag. Indicates whether the regulator is ready
mbed_official 610:813dcc80987e 194 * in the selected voltage range or is still changing to the required voltage level.
mbed_official 610:813dcc80987e 195 * @arg PWR_FLAG_PVDO: Power Voltage Detector Output. Indicates whether VDD voltage is
mbed_official 610:813dcc80987e 196 * below or above the selected PVD threshold.
mbed_official 610:813dcc80987e 197 * @arg PWR_FLAG_PVMO1: Peripheral Voltage Monitoring Output 1. Indicates whether VDDUSB voltage is
mbed_official 610:813dcc80987e 198 * is below or above PVM1 threshold (applicable when USB feature is supported).
mbed_official 610:813dcc80987e 199 * @arg PWR_FLAG_PVMO2: Peripheral Voltage Monitoring Output 2. Indicates whether VDDIO2 voltage is
mbed_official 610:813dcc80987e 200 * is below or above PVM2 threshold (applicable when VDDIO2 is present on device).
mbed_official 610:813dcc80987e 201 * @arg PWR_FLAG_PVMO3: Peripheral Voltage Monitoring Output 3. Indicates whether VDDA voltage is
mbed_official 610:813dcc80987e 202 * is below or above PVM3 threshold.
mbed_official 610:813dcc80987e 203 * @arg PWR_FLAG_PVMO4: Peripheral Voltage Monitoring Output 4. Indicates whether VDDA voltage is
mbed_official 610:813dcc80987e 204 * is below or above PVM4 threshold.
mbed_official 610:813dcc80987e 205 *
mbed_official 610:813dcc80987e 206 * @retval The new state of __FLAG__ (TRUE or FALSE).
mbed_official 610:813dcc80987e 207 */
mbed_official 610:813dcc80987e 208 #define __HAL_PWR_GET_FLAG(__FLAG__) ( ((((uint8_t)(__FLAG__)) >> 5U) == 1) ?\
mbed_official 610:813dcc80987e 209 (PWR->SR1 & (1U << ((__FLAG__) & 31U))) :\
mbed_official 610:813dcc80987e 210 (PWR->SR2 & (1U << ((__FLAG__) & 31U))) )
